C20orf30 GI:58331120 hypothetical protein LOC29058 isoform 1 1 mqpwalptvg elwvcgrpga alrwslvlsp rlepsgvisa hcnlhllass 50 51 dssasasrlc qrvmmpsrtn latgipsskv kysrlsstdd gyidlqfkkt 100 101 ppkipykaia latvlfliga fliiigslll sgyiskggad ravpvliigi 150 151 lvflpgfyhl riayyaskgy rgysyddipd fdd